Dopplr
A social travel network that let users coordinate trips and share travel plans with their contact list.

Key Events Timeline
FOUNDING
Dopplr founded as a social travel network service in the UK.
ACQUISITION ATTEMPT
Nokia acquires Dopplr for approximately $20 million, signaling the beginning of the end.
DECLINE
Post-acquisition, user value and engagement begin to collapse as Nokia neglects platform development.
SHUTDOWN
Nokia shuts down Dopplr in late 2013, ending the platform permanently.
